    A Way To Turn Vocals Off

    Shadowbringers has some of the best music in the series and shout out to the composers for a job well done but alot of songs for me personally are outright ruined by obnoxious repetitive singers blaring in the background.

    I dont mind instances like the regular battle theme where the vocalist has only 1 part and she doesnt take over the rest of the music.

    But places like Greatwood, where I'm just walking around talking to people, I have this annoying lady just spewing nonsense at me. Which is a shame cause the music itself is actually very relaxing.

    And fights like Titania, good lord I don't know what's creepier, the psycho delusional fem child throwing plants at me or the hyper squeaky pixies wailing about while I'm trying to put a cap in the crazy ladies skull.

    I've seen games where they keep the music itself but flick off the vocalists, and I think an option like that would be wonderful especially for those of us who enjoy instrumental pieces.

    I just dont like walking around with some rando singing in my ear its obnoxious. And I know some may say *well turn the music off* uhhh no. This game has so much customization and options, I dont see why this cant be an option too.

    I mean... you realise that Titania is supposed to be kinda creepy and that the music helps to set that atmosphere...?

    While I could maybe see some option that would allow you to either play only day-time or night-time music (which would fix your Rak'Tika problem, since the nighttime-music is a piano-version without vocals), I cant help but find your request and specially the way you worded it mainly disrespectful and... sad. I mean, its fine that you dont like certain pieces of music, but I feel you dont realise that those pieces were most likely composed with a certain vision in mind, to create a special atmosphere for a fight or a place and while I'm usually on board with suggestions that allows people to "ruin" the game for themself and not playing it the way it was intended, I'm having trouble getting behind this one. Maybe I'm biased because I love both the Rak'Tika and Titania theme, specially for the vocals, and think that Soken and every involved musician did an outstanding job there.

    Personally I dont see how this option is truely needed *shrug* Sometimes I feel we should have to "put up" with how the devs invisioned their game and the atmosphere they wanted to create in certain parts of it.

    In addition to that: I'm pretty sure the songs we hear are already mixed and done, so turning on and off the vocals would require them to put in the song twice - one time with vocals, one time without. It might not be as simple as you think it is, seeing how sound always seems to give them a little headache (considering that we cant switch it freely or how mounts can always only play one theme)

    (btw: have you considered to just turn mount music on and walk around with whatever song your mount plays instead of the zone music?)
